Prerequisites:
Section of train tracks with at least one station
Steps to reproduce:
1. Place train down not on train station
2. Insert a singular unit of fuel
3. Make train go to the station thus consuming fuel and having it as a red bar
4. Make a blueprint of this setup that includes train
Expected behavior:
Single half consumed unit of fuel is displayed as Vehicle fuel
Current behavior:
Fuel that is in half used state is not considered Vehicle fuel for purposes of blueprinting
Note:
I understand that considering this half used fuel may lead to overflowing requests where parked trains request 4 Nuclear fuel where only 3 can be inserted. Nonetheless this is annoying when planning train features and needing to insert 2 pieces of fuel to actually blueprint required fuel.
